Le Meilleur Pâtissier winner at Constance Belle Mare Plage

 

We had the immense pleasure of welcoming Manon, winner of Le Meilleur Pâtissier Season 11, at Constance Belle Mare Plage recently. Beloved for her warm, generous spirit, Manon made a memorable impression during the 18 edition of Constance Festival Culinaire in Mauritius.

She described the experience as “nothing short of incredible.”  Here’s her full impression of the annual culinary event.

"I never imagined a culinary festival could so beautifully embody values like sharing, joy, and excellence," she shared. From the flawless organisation to the enriching activities, the festival exceeded all her expectations.

As a passionate pâtissière, Manon felt right at home. The festival provided her with the opportunity to connect with fellow pastry chefs, attend prestigious competitions, and, most importantly, engage in meaningful conversations about the shared love of pâtisserie.



"This invitation was completely in line with who I am. I got to meet chefs, savour new creations, and dive deep into the passion that unites us all."

One of the festival’s greatest gifts to her? Unexpected flavour combinations. "They opened my mind and sparked my creativity, it's truly inspiring," she said.

Manon also cherished her encounters with culinary icons such as Pierre Sang and Mercotte, describing these exchanges as one of the festival’s standout elements. "Sharing their talent and passion in such a beautiful setting, it was unforgettable."

When asked what makes Constance Festival Culinaire unique, her answer was clear: "The values that shine through: sharing, simplicity, and joy. You have to live it to truly feel it."
